  • Read on for answers to some of the more common
    questions surrounding NYC building violations
  • Q. I need to look at the violation Ive received
    and my court date how do I do that?
  • A. By visiting the department of buildings
    website and entering your propertys information
    in the panel on the left-hand side.

3
  • Q. If I cant attend court on the scheduled
    hearing date, what should I do?
  • A. If you fail to show up to a scheduled hearing,
    youll default on the violation. In some
    instances, a specialist violation removal firm
    can represent you.
  • Q. Notices from the ECB state that I owe money
    for a violation I know nothing about, what should
    I do?
  • A. If you reach out to a company who deal with
    violation removals, they may be able to get you a
    new court date before a maximum penalty is
    imposed. If its too late, however, they may
    still be able to reduce the fine.

4
  • Q. Can I avoid a penalty for an ECB violation?
  • A. if your violation notice has a cure date,
    then you may be able to correct the violation
    before that date and avoid paying a fine to the
    court.
  • Q. What is a stipulation?
  • A. This is an agreement in which you plead guilty
    to the violation, and is between you and the
    Department of Buildings. Youre given extra time
    to correct the violation and a reduced penalty.

5
  • Q. The violation still shows as open even
    though Ive paid it?
  • A. The violation must not only be paid for, but
    corrected file a Certificate of Correction for
    approval from the DOB.
  • Q. My building has open violations, is this cause
    for concern?
  • A. Yes. Until you resolve the violation, youll
    continue to receive penalties.
  • Q. What is a vacate order?
  • A. This order from the DOB, instructs you to
    vacate the part of the premises deemed unsafe for
    habitation, and its important that you dont
    remove the order from your property, or you will
    face a stiff penalty.

6
  • Q. Ive been issued with a stop work order
    what is it?
  • A. Issued by the DOB when, following an
    inspection, hazardous or unsafe work conditions
    are discovered, a stop work order is designed
    to protect workers, tenants and the public from
    unsafe work, or work carried out in the absence
    of a permit. Again, its important that you dont
    remove the notice, and dont violate it in any
    way.
  • Q. Do I need to repair my sidewalk after
    receiving a violation?
  • A. Youll need to make the repairs to the
    sidewalk in question, and this type of violation
    typically includes cracks or uneven concrete that
    can present a tripping hazard. Find a good
    construction company well versed in violation
    removals, and get the problem solved fast.
